In Rafa's recent interview:

We know Daniel Agger is out for the rest of the season - can you just give us a bit more detail about his situation?
 
We were expecting to see him very soon because he was playing with the reserve team. But after every game he was feeling pain so the doctor we spoke to said he could carry on with the pain because the operation would be the last thing to consider. But he couldn't continue so on Monday he will have an operation and although he will miss the rest of the season, he should be ready for the start of the next season.

It's disappointing for the lad and for us to be sure--he's a talented player and has skills on the ball that none of our other CBs quite match.  That said, I think this could be a tiny blessing in disguise.  The last thing we need during this run-in--as we face a challenging time in both the league and the CL--is to worry about working another CB into the mix.  We've already got Carra moving to RB on occasion to accommodate Skrtel and I just don't want to see any more experiments.  Skrtel seems very solid and is adapting quickly, whilst Sami has been immense and we all know Carra's quality.  Perhaps having the Dane out of the picture until the pre-season will keep things nice and simple.
